CF Big 4 is a one step down from IBD (your job is similar, but you'll work with smaller deals). I'm an intern at CF Big 4. Exit opp is similar to IBD, you can go PE/HF but I reckon it will be harder, then make sure you network like crazy and get into a top 10 MBA. Or if you're on dat Big 4 partner life it could be sweet too.

I don't know about Deloitte/PwC Strat but maybe it's also a step down from MBB. Then I guess you the exit opps are similar to consulting (not my area of knowledge).
